Game&Fish1Bismarck (CSi)  The ND Game & Fish Department reminds hunters that the Hunter Education Classes are set in Valley City.

Classes will be held March 10, 12, 16, 17 & 19, 2015,  from 6pm to 9:30pm at the Valley City State University Rhoades Science Center.

The Hunter Safety classes are sponsored by the Barnes County Wildlife Club.

Hunter education is mandatory for youth who are turning 12 years old. Children can take the class at age 11.

North Dakota law requires anyone born after Dec. 31, 1961, to pass a certified hunter education course to hunt in the state.
